Meanings for mazurka

a Polish national dance in triple time
0 rating rating ratings
music composed for dancing the mazurka
0 rating rating ratings
It is a Polish stylized folk dance that was popular in Europe and the United States in the mid to late nineteenth century.

Wiki content for mazurka

Mazurka - The Mazurka (Polish: mazurek or mazur) is a Polish folk dance in triple meter, usually at a lively tempo, and with "strong accents unsystematically placed on the second or third beat".
Mazurkas, Op. 17 (Chopin) - Mazurkas, Op. 17 is a set of four mazurkas for piano by Frédéric Chopin, composed and published between 1832 and 1833. A typical performance of the set lasts about fourteen minutes.
Mazurkas (Chopin) - Over the years 1825–1849, Frédéric Chopin wrote at least 59 mazurkas for piano, based on the traditional Polish dance:
Mazurkas, Op. 41 (Chopin) - Mazurkas, Op. 41 is a set of four mazurkas for piano by Frédéric Chopin, composed and published between 1838 and 1839. A typical performance of the set lasts about nine and a half minutes.
Mazurkas, Op. 59 (Chopin) - Mazurkas, Op. 59 are a set of three Mazurkas for solo piano by Frédéric Chopin. The set was composed and published in 1845.
